How we intend to use sound

For our sound we have designed the movie to work alongside the sound. In the few second fade's between scene's we will have diegetic sound of sirens, gunshots and screams. As most of the movie is based in the protagonists returning memories, there will be lots of diegetic sounds, especially in the bar, with foley sounds from that pub  of people talking. We will have music as diegetic sound from the pub, however no music will fit the rest of the movie.

We will use an non-diegetic eerie sound throughout the film which creates tension in the audience, this will start when we first see Rick (protagonist) tied on his chair and it will intensify throughout each scene until a sudden stop at the end of the grave digging scene. The grave scene will be silent other than the eerie sound and sound effect of a shovel digging into the ground.

We will have dialogue in our film in the Pub and the interrogation scenes. This will be used to make the audience ask questions on the situation that Rick is in. Sound should always be there and should never be silence in a movie.
